Selling off my collection of MXers and enduros. Next up is a nice TS400 Apache that I have owned for the past 5 years. It has always started on the 2 or 3rd kick with the choke. Easy kick through. Never any issues. A great bike for tooling around town and adventure riding or a good candidate for a full restoration. Brakes, blinkers, horn and headlights work.

Frame number- TS4003 11340  Engine Number- TS4003 11148  I do not believe that the frame and numbers ever matched for this model

No reserve so it will sell. I will work with your shipper.

This is the 4th bike up for sale. Two TM400s and an AJS Stormer 410 have already sold.

The tank has its original paint, both sides of the tank look great but the top is faded. I tried to take a good picture of the top of the tank but there is a lot of glare even late in the evening. I believe that the side panels and fenders have been repainted an look very good. The headlight bucket looks better in photos than in person. 

See the photo. I am including passenger foot pegs, rider foot peg, a front fender and a new gas cap with a key with the sale. The current gas cap does not have the lock and is held closed with a cotter pin that slides in and out. I've used it that way for years. I bought the extra gas cap on ebay and just can't figure out how it works.

Electric Motorcycle Conversion

Fri, 30 Jan 2009

Donald and Andrew Higginbotham, are a father and son team that converted a Suzuki RF900 into an electric motorcycle at their home over the course of three months worth of Saturdays. It ended up costing about $3,000 to complete with parts from Electric Motorsport. The bike gets about 35 miles per charge at a maximum speed of 55mph.

Isle of Man TT 2012: Sidecar TT Race 1 Results

Mon, 04 Jun 2012

Dave Molyneux won his 15th career Isle of Man TT race with a victory in the first Sure Sidecar TT race of the 2012 festival. The win comes in Molyneux’s return to the Isle of Man TT after sitting out last year’s competition. By far the most successful Sidecar racer in TT history Molyneux is third overall among riders in any class, behind Joey Dunlop (26) and John McGuinness (18).
